Foundation Damage Repair Services
Foundation damage repair involves assessing and addressing issues that compromise the structural integrity of a building’s foundation. This process typically begins with a thorough inspection to identify signs of damage, such as cracks in walls or floors, uneven settling, or visible shifts in the foundation. Once problems are diagnosed, specialists may employ various techniques to stabilize and restore the foundation’s stability. These methods can include underpinning, piering, slab jacking, or the installation of additional supports, all aimed at preventing further deterioration and ensuring the safety of the property.
This service helps resolve common problems caused by foundation damage, including foundation settling, shifting, or cracking that can lead to structural instability. Over time, issues such as so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or construction can weaken a foundation. Repairing these issues not only helps prevent further damage but also reduces the risk of costly repairs to other parts of the property, like walls, floors, and ceilings. Addressing foundation problems early can preserve the property's value and improve its safety and livability.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Damage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lebanon, IN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Foundation Damage Repair Costs - Typically, repair costs can range from $2,000 to $7,000 depending on the extent of damage. Minor cracks may cost closer to $2,000, while significant foundation issues could reach $7,000 or more.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ific conditions.
Type of Repairs and Pricing - The cost varies with the type of repair needed, such as crack injections or underpinning. For example, crack injections might cost around $1,500 to $3,000, whereas underpinning can range from $4,000 to $10,000. Prices depend on the severity and size of the foundation damage.
Factors Influencing Costs - Foundation repair costs are influenced by soil conditions, foundation size, and accessibility. Repairs in Lebanon, IN, typically fall within the general range, but complex cases may require higher investments. Local service providers can assess and give tailored cost estimates.
Additional Expenses - Additional costs may include excavation, soil stabilization, or waterproofing, which can add $1,000 to $5,000 to the overall project. These expenses depend on the specific foundation issues and site conditions encountered by local contractors.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Foundation damage repair services are often sought by property owners in Lebanon, IN when they notice signs of shifting or settling in their homes. Common indicators include cracked wal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that no longer close properly. These issues can be caused by soil movement, poor drainage, or natural settling over time, prompting owners to seek professional assistance to address the underlying problems and prevent further structural complications.
Homeowners may also look for foundation repair when they observe water pooling around their foundation or experience increased moisture levels inside their basements. Such conditions can weaken the foundation’s stability and lead to more extensive damage if not addressed promptly.
